Defining a Real-Money Casino and How It Operates

A real-money casino is simply any platform where you deposit and wager actual currency, with the chance to win cash payouts. It operates by converting your funds into credits for games like slots, blackjack, or roulette, then tracking your wins or losses in real-time. The house always retains a calculated edge, ensuring long-term profitability, but short-term outcomes rely entirely on chance or skill-based rules. Your payout is never guaranteed, making bankroll management a core part of the experience. When you request a withdrawal, the casino processes it through secure payment methods, returning your funds to your preferred account. Every spin or hand is immediately settled, meaning your balance updates instantly, and all transactions are tied to that real money you risked.

Payment methods that support fast deposits and reliable cashouts

For real-money casino play, prioritize payment methods offering instant deposit processing to begin sessions without delay. E-wallets like Skrill and Neteller often credit funds in under a minute, while cryptocurrencies can finalize deposits within seconds. For cashouts, choose platforms supporting withdrawals to the same method used for deposit to avoid verification bottlenecks. A clear sequence for reliable access includes:

  1. Select a method with zero withdrawal fees and a stated processing time (e.g., 24 hours for e-wallets).
  2. Complete identity verification pre-cashout to prevent holds.
  3. Verify the platform does not impose minimum cashout thresholds exceeding $10.

Crucially, avoid methods requiring manual bank transfers for withdrawals, as these often take 3–5 business days.

Understanding payout rates and game fairness

Understanding payout rates and game fairness is crucial when picking a real-money site. Look for high RTP percentages—ideally 96% or above—since they show how much you’ll potentially get back over time. Check for games certified by independent testing agencies to ensure outcomes are truly random. A simple sequence to follow:

  1. Find the RTP for each slot or table game listed.
  2. Verify the site displays a fairness certificate or audit seal.
  3. Test a few free demo rounds to see if results feel consistent.

Unfair games often hide or inflate their payout percentages, so always dig into this data before depositing.

Is it safe to enter my payment details on these sites?

Legitimate real-money casino sites protect your payment details through encryption, such as 256-bit SSL technology, which scrambles data during transmission. Before entering any information, verify the site uses a secure connection (look for “https” in the URL). Reputable platforms also store card numbers in tokenized form, meaning the casino never accesses your full details. However, if a site lacks clear privacy policies or prompts payment through unsecured pop-ups, avoid submitting your information. Stick to well-known payment methods like e-wallets or credit cards, as these offer additional fraud protection layers. Entering payment details on these sites is only safe when the casino actively demonstrates these technical safeguards.

How long do withdrawals typically take to process?

Withdrawal processing times at a real-money casino vary by method. E-wallets like PayPal or Skrill typically clear within 24 hours, while bank transfers can take 3–5 business days. Processing speeds depend on verification status; unverified accounts often cause delays. The sequence is:

  1. Request submitted and pending review
  2. Casino processes the request
  3. Funds hit your chosen method

Some casinos impose a 48-hour pending period before processing begins. Credit cards usually take 1–3 business days, while cryptocurrency withdrawals are often near-instant.

What happens if I encounter a technical glitch during a bet?

If you encounter a technical glitch during a bet at a real-money casino, the outcome depends on the game state. If the bet is placed and processed before the glitch, your wager stands and the result will be determined once the game resumes or is reviewed. For in-progress spins or hands, most reputable platforms invoke a “faulty game” policy, voiding the round and refunding your stake. Technical glitch during a bet resolution typically requires contacting support immediately, providing a timestamp and screenshot. Q: What happens if I encounter a technical glitch during a bet? A: The casino usually refunds the bet if the game cannot be completed, or settles it based on the last recorded server data.
